Epiroc Completes Acquisition Of Weco, A Rock Drilling Parts Manufacturer In South Africa. Epiroc, a leading productivity and sustainability partner for the mining and construction industries, has completed the acquisition of the business of Weco Proprietary Limited, a South African manufacturer of precision-engineered rock drilling parts and provider of related repairs and services.

Weco is based near Johannesburg, South Africa. The company, which has more than four decades of industry experience and has about 80 employees. Weco’s customers are mainly underground mining companies in the Southern African region. Epiroc announced on December 12, 2023, that it had agreed to acquire Weco. The parties have agreed not to disclose the purchase price as the transaction is not subject to a disclosure obligation pursuant to the EU Market Abuse Regulation.

“This acquisition will strengthen our manufacturing capabilities and expand our product portfolio of spare parts in the growing and important African region,” says Helena Hedblom, Epiroc’s President and CEO. “We look forward to welcoming the strong team at Weco to the Epiroc Group.”
